The Time Difference between Spain and Greece

The time difference between Spain and Greece is one hour. Greece follows Eastern European Time (EET), which is GMT+2, whereas Spain follows Central European Time (CET), which is GMT+1. Therefore, when it’s noon in Spain, it is 1 p.m. in Greece, all depending on the book or device you’re checking the time from.

Q: Are there any visa requirements for traveling between Spain and Greece?
A: If you are an EU citizen, you do not need a visa to travel from Spain to Greece or vice versa. However, if you are from a non-EU country, you may need a Schengen visa, which allows you to travel within the Schengen Area, including both Spain and Greece. Contact your local embassy or consulate for more information.
